Good new Kia fans from across Euro, the brand is finally going sporty at a time we least expected it to. The new pro_cee’d is finally getting that hot version we’ve always wanted. The previous generation used to have a 140 horsepower 2-liter, but they’ve taken things to a whole new level this time.
This is the very first time that the pro-cee’d GT has been spotted testing, as it’s getting ready for its big launch in mid-2013. The coupe is sporty all around, from the styling to the engine. Speaking of the engine, downsizing is the key word, as it packs a new 1.6-liter GDI motor with direct injection, a twin-scroll turbo, as well as strengthened internals that produces 204 horsepower and 265 Nm (195 lb-ft) of torque, working together with a six-speed manual gearbox.
The result of all that power isn’t that impressive on paper. Despite more power than the new Clio RS or Fiesta ST, it only gets from 0 to 100 km/h in 7.9 seconds. But we have to take into consideration that this is a class above in size.
This Astra GTC rival will hit the market with new front and rear fascias, modified headlights, as well as a new front grille and a set of 18-inch alloy wheels. Bucket seats should be standard, but don’t expect a cheap deal at your local dealer as a result.
